Overall Meaning

The lyrics to Me'Shell Ndegéocello's song Sweet Love explore the painful and often complicated nature of unrequited love. The singer is a woman who goes to great lengths to try and please the object of her affection, even though she knows deep down that he doesn't care about her in the same way. She struggles with her own conflicting emotions, torn between her love for him and her own pride. Despite knowing that there will always be someone else by his side, she can't help but long for him and plead with him to let her make sweet love to him.


The song also touches on themes of loneliness and desperation, as the singer cries her tears by candlelight and imagines her lover with another woman. She is so consumed by her love for him that she even contemplates making love to someone else just to ease her pain. Ultimately, the song is a raw and honest portrayal of the heartache that comes with unrequited love.
